There are both inpatient and outpatient drug and alcohol rehab, but there are a few sub-categories of outpatient drug and alcohol treatment in Petersburg from which to choose. Typical outpatient care is minimally invasive and individuals can usually attend counseling and therapy a few times a week. Intensive outpatient rehabs offer counseling and therapy much like normal outpatient, but on a more intensive pace that also allows time for family and work life.
One outpatient drug treatment option referred to as Day Treatment or Partial Hospitalization is the most comprehensive form of outpatient treatment available. Clients can still go home or to a halfway house at the end of each day, but will spend the majority of their time involved in outpatient treatment activities. Day treatment and partial hospitalization outpatient drug treatment is ideal for people who have newly completed an inpatient rehab, but still need to maintain a robust support system while becoming more comfortable with a sober life. These programs also tend to offer a wider spectrum of services that normal outpatient may not offer, including alternative therapies, medication management, and dual-diagnosis treatment.
It is common for clients in outpatient drug and alcohol rehab or after rehab in outpatient drug and alcohol rehab to relapse. In these situations inpatient treatment would correctly be the next step.
